A spherical mirror is a mirror that has the shape of a piece cut out of a spherical surface. There are two types of spherical mirrors: concave and convex mirror.Spherical Mirror a mirror with a surface that is either concave or convex and forms a portion of a true sphere

Spherical mirrors :

\longmapsto Mirrors having curved reflecting surface are called spherical mirrors.

There are two types of spherical mirrors :

  1. Concave Mirrors
  2. Convex Mirrors

Concave Mirrors :

\longmapsto A mirror whose reflecting surface is towards the centre of curvature is called as concave mirror.

›»› Characteristics of concave mirrors :

  • Reflecting surface is curved inwards.

  • Image formed is real and inverted except when the object is closer to the mirror.

  • Image formed is either enlarged or diminished.

Convex Mirrors :

\longmapsto A mirror whose reflecting surface is on the opposite surface of centre of curvature is called as convex mirror.

›»› Characteristics of convex mirrors :

  • Reflecting surface is curved outwards.

  • Image formed is virtual and erect.

  • Image formed is diminished.
